What Features Define the Best Tote Bag Pattern?
When selecting the best tote bag pattern, several key features should be considered to ensure functionality and style:
-
Size and Dimensions: The perfect tote bag pattern should provide various size options. A larger tote is ideal for carrying groceries or beach essentials, while a smaller version suits day-to-day errands.
-
Design Versatility: A great pattern accommodates different styles, from casual to chic. This versatility allows the bag to fit seamlessly into various settings, whether it’s for work or leisure.
-
Handle Length: Consider patterns with both short and long handles. Longer straps offer more carrying options, allowing users to wear the bag on their shoulder or as a crossbody, enhancing comfort.
-
Pocket Placement: The best patterns incorporate pockets for organization—both interior and exterior pockets can help keep essentials like phones, keys, and wallets easily accessible.
-
Fabric Compatibility: Look for patterns that suggest a range of fabric options, like canvas, denim, or lightweight cotton, which can influence the tote’s durability and aesthetic appeal.
-
Ease of Construction: A well-designed pattern will include clear instructions and minimal complex techniques, making it accessible for sewists of all skill levels.
These features contribute significantly to the utility and appeal of the tote bag, ensuring it meets the practical needs of the user while remaining stylish.

What Tote Bag Sizes Are Considered Ideal for Different Purposes?
The ideal tote bag sizes vary based on their intended use, ensuring functionality and convenience.
- Small Tote Bags (10-12 inches wide): These compact bags are perfect for quick errands or outings where you only need to carry essentials like a wallet, phone, and keys. Their lightweight design makes them easy to carry, and they often serve as stylish accessories.
- Medium Tote Bags (13-16 inches wide): Ideal for daily use, medium tote bags offer ample space for items like a lunch box, a book, or a tablet. They strike a balance between being spacious enough for everyday necessities while still being manageable for regular carry.
- Large Tote Bags (17-20 inches wide): These bags are designed for more extensive outings, such as beach trips or shopping excursions, where you might need to carry a larger amount of items. Their spacious interiors can accommodate everything from clothing and towels to groceries, making them versatile and functional.
- Extra-Large Tote Bags (21 inches and above): Perfect for travel or special events, extra-large tote bags can carry bulky items like sports equipment, picnic supplies, or weekend getaway essentials. Their generous capacity makes them a favorite for anyone needing to transport larger loads.
- Specialty Tote Bags: Some tote bags are designed for specific purposes, such as diaper bags or gym bags, featuring additional compartments and pockets. These bags cater to unique needs, ensuring organization and convenience for tasks like parenting or exercising.

What Are Some Great DIY Patterns for Beginner Sewers?
There are several great DIY patterns suitable for beginner sewers, particularly for making tote bags.
- Simple Tote Bag: This pattern typically involves basic rectangular shapes for the body and handles, making it easy to cut and sew. It’s perfect for beginners as it requires minimal fabric and no complex techniques, allowing new sewers to practice their straight stitching skills.
- Reversible Tote Bag: A reversible tote bag pattern offers the chance to create two bags in one, using different fabrics on each side. This project introduces beginners to sewing techniques such as topstitching and attaching handles securely, while also providing the satisfaction of a versatile finished product.
- Drawstring Tote Bag: This pattern incorporates a drawstring closure, which adds a fun element to the traditional tote. While it requires a bit more sewing knowledge, such as creating casing for the drawstring, it helps beginners learn about finishing techniques and working with different types of fabric.
- Patchwork Tote Bag: A patchwork tote bag allows beginners to experiment with different fabric scraps, making it a creative and resourceful project. This pattern encourages the practice of piecing together fabric and can help sewers develop their skills in color coordination and design layout.
- Quilted Tote Bag: For those looking to add texture and durability, a quilted tote bag pattern introduces the concept of layering fabrics. While it requires slightly more advanced techniques, such as quilting the layers together, it can be a rewarding project that results in a sturdy and stylish bag.
How Can You Personalize the Best Tote Bag Pattern to Reflect Your Style?
To personalize the best tote bag pattern to reflect your style, consider the following elements:
- Fabric Choice: Selecting the right fabric is crucial for personalization, as it can dramatically change the look of your tote. You can opt for bold prints, subtle textures, or eco-friendly materials that resonate with your personal aesthetic and values.
- Color Palette: The colors you choose can convey your personality and mood. Whether you prefer vibrant hues or muted tones, a well-thought-out color scheme can make your tote bag a true reflection of your style.
- Embellishments: Adding embellishments such as patches, embroidery, or beads can give your tote a unique flair. These decorative elements allow you to express your creativity and can be customized to incorporate personal symbols or favorite motifs.
- Size and Shape: Altering the size and shape of the tote bag can influence its functionality and style. Whether you prefer a large, slouchy bag or a structured, compact design, tailoring the dimensions will help suit your everyday needs and fashion preferences.
- Personalized Monograms: Incorporating initials or names into the design can add a personal touch. Monograms can be stitched or printed on the tote, making it a distinctive item that showcases your identity.
- Interior Organization: Customizing the inside of your tote with pockets, compartments, or a lining that reflects your style can enhance both practicality and aesthetics. This allows you to keep your belongings organized while still staying true to your personal taste.
